How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Hunters Glen?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Hunters Glen Studio Apartments | $1,473 | $1,239 | $1,950 |
Hunters Glen 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,535 | $825 | $4,817 |
Hunters Glen 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,926 | $1,125 | $6,305 |
Hunters Glen 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,571 | $1,579 | $6,192 |
Hunters Glen 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,027 | $2,999 | $10,000+ |
